Pros

This did give me an opportunity to move up in my career. I don't regret taking on this job, but do regret putting so much into it.

Cons

The "Helpful" reviews here are already spot on. Be prepared to deal with pathological liars and folks who do favors outside of work to get what they want. There are also no performance review cycles, so good luck trying to fix any systemic issues at their core. Read: You can't. There are no actual career ladders and the one HR rolled out is a joke. Don't expect significant bumps or promotions after you negotiate your initial offer. Especially if you're a person with integrity and won't lie/do favors to advance. The equity isn't worth staying for as it is stingy for their size compared to other SF tech companies. The burnout is real. Get what you need from here and move out.

Pros

- Strong platform - Mostly friendly and smart people - Good salary, but substandard benefits

Cons

- Strong culture of favoritism: if you’re not an OG or coming in from Palo Alto, you’ll face an uphill battle in sales. - Sales culture is terribly toxic, political, and cliquey, especially with the Palo Alto Networks invasion. - Ridiculous internal processes and poorly designed tools (still use more spreadsheets than tools, quotes can take weeks and I’m not kidding) - Zero sales tools (No Outreach, Gong, good luck even getting Zoom Info) - Substandard BDR team with 12:1 ratios of BDR to AE. Got zero set meetings in over 1 year with our team’s BDR.
